General Description
The LM3706/LM3707 series of microprocessor supervisory
circuits provide the maximum flexibility for monitoring power
supplies and battery controlled functions in systems without
backup batteries. The LM3706/LM3707 series are available
in a 9-bump micro SMD package.
Built-in features include the following:
Reset: Reset is asserted during power-up, power-down, and
brownout conditions. RESET is guaranteed down to V
1.0V.
Low Line Output: This early power failure warning indicator
goes low when the supply voltage drops to a value which is
2% higher than the reset threshold voltage.
Watchdog Timer: The WDI (Watchdog Input) monitors one of
the µP’s output lines for activity. If no output transition occurs
during the watchdog timeout period, reset is activated.
